
CD-R Goes Mobile as Portable CD-R
Solution Premieres
CD-Recordable technology hit
the road in September 1996 when Portable Systems Solutions, Inc. announced the
PortaSCSI ShareStore recording solution, a portable system that enables users
to record CDs from PC-compatible notebooks and desktop systems without having
to install the drive or controller. The ShareStore solution bundles the 2X
write/6X read Phillips CD-R with Portable Systems Solutions' Advanced Mobile
PortaSCSI technology and ships with a variety of software applications to
support mobile CD recording and CD backup. Using a standard parallel port and
the SCSI-2 PortaSCSI interface, the sharable CD recorder - also dubbed
ShareStore - is designed to move fluidly among various computer systems for
flexible backup performance and carries a list price of $299.
